FAQs about Filming Locations in Philadelphia, PA

What's the average cost of renting filming locations in Philadelphia?

The cost of filming in Philadelphia will vary depending on a number of factors, including the duration of your shoot, the number of locations you use, and the size of your crew. However, you can expect to pay between $50 to $100 per hour. Keep in mind that some filming studios may charge additional fees for equipment rental or for the use of specific props or sets. Do I need a permit for my filming projects in Philadelphia?

To secure a filming permit in Philadelphia, filmmakers must first complete an application that includes details such as the desired shooting dates, locations, and the size of the production crew. The permits differ depending on the type of filming project and the specific locations being used. If approved, a permit will be issued, outlining any specific conditions or requirements for the production. We recommend planning ahead and allowing sufficient time for the permit application process, as it may take several weeks to obtain approval. Visit the Greater Philadelphia Film Office for more information on the application process and to access the necessary forms.

What factors should I consider when choosing filming locations in Philadelphia?

Choosing the right shooting spots in Philadelphia is crucial for the success of your project. Here are several factors to consider:

  • Logistics and Facilities: Consider the accessibility of the location for crew and equipment, as well as the availability of necessary facilities such as restrooms and parking. Additionally, consider any specific requirements your project may have, such as the need for a green room or dressing rooms for actors.
  • Weather: Take into account the weather conditions of the location during the time of your project. If your project requires specific weather conditions, such as a sunny day for an outdoor shoot, make sure to research the historical weather patterns of the location during that time of year.
  • Aesthetics and Cinematography: Consider the overall look and feel of the location and how it aligns with the visual style you want to achieve for your project. Look for unique features or landscapes that can enhance your cinematography, such as picturesque views or interesting architectural elements.
